wget не может установить SSL-соединение в bash-скрипте - PullRequest
0 голосов
/ 06 марта 2019

Следующая команда работает в командной строке:

wget --secure-protocol=PFS -O dcm4chee-arc-5.15.1-mysql.zip https://sourceforge.net/projects/dcm4che/files/dcm4chee-arc-light5/5.15.1/dcm4chee-arc-5.15.1-mysql.zip/download

Однако, когда я помещаю точно такую ​​же строку в скрипт bash (он внутри функции), это приводит к этой ошибке:

Разрешение sourceforge.net (sourceforge.net) ... 216.105.38.13

Подключение к sourceforge.net (sourceforge.net) | 216.105.38.13 |: 443 ... подключено.

Невозможно установить соединение SSL.

Я даже вытащил его из функции, чтобы посмотреть, имеет ли это какое-то значение, но это не так.

Есть мысли?

1 Ответ

0 голосов
/ 06 марта 2019

Ударяя себя ... моя IDE имела #!/usr/bin/env bash в верхней части файла, тогда как изменение его на просто #!/bin/bash заставило все работать как положено.Я благодарю всех за ответы, зачисляя @Mihai с прямой помощью из-за комментария об «окружающей среде»

...